Off-Duty Federal Officer Stops Potential Mass Shooting at Virginia Grocery Store

CROZET, VA — A deadly attack in the parking lot of a Harris Teeter grocery store on Saturday, February 17, 2025, was stopped by an off-duty federal law enforcement officer, preventing what officials say could have been a higher casualty event.

According to the Albemarle County Police Department (ACPD), the attacker arrived at the store’s parking lot and opened fire with an AR-15 rifle. His first victim, 43-year-old Peter L. Martin of Crozet, was shot as he exited the store and was pronounced dead at the scene. The attacker then approached 68-year-old Diane G. Spangler, who was inside her vehicle. Spangler was critically wounded and transported to UVA Medical Center, where she later succumbed to her injuries.

Just 20 seconds into the attack, an off-duty federal law enforcement officer who was exiting the store heard the gunfire and immediately engaged the shooter with their personal weapon. The attacker was shot and pronounced dead at the scene. The officer was uninjured.

ACPD Chief Sean Reeves praised the off-duty officer’s swift and decisive action, stating, “This heroic individual selflessly placed themselves in harm’s way to stop the gunman and prevent further loss of life. Without their brave actions, there’s no doubt the casualty count could have been much higher.”

Investigators are still working to determine a motive for the attack. Police stated that the shooter had prior contact with law enforcement in January 2025 but did not have a criminal history. At this time, there is no confirmed connection between the attacker and his victims.

Authorities have recovered multiple firearms, including the AR-15 used in the attack. Additional weapons were visible in the shooter’s vehicle, and investigators are executing search warrants to determine the exact number of firearms and rounds of ammunition involved.

The Importance of Armed Citizens in Public Spaces

This incident underscores how quickly violent attacks can unfold and the critical role that armed individuals—whether law enforcement or trained citizens—can play in stopping threats. The off-duty federal officer’s ability to act within seconds likely saved lives.

For those who legally carry a firearm, this tragedy highlights the importance of ongoing training, situational awareness, and preparedness. While law enforcement officers and first responders arrive as quickly as possible, violent attacks can happen in an instant, making self-defense skills and a proactive mindset invaluable in protecting oneself and others.
